Using the Operator Panel
Pressing U or V toggles through the serial parameters as follows. To change the serial parameter, press [OK] ([ENTER]). Use U or V to change the value or selection.
>Baud Rate 9600
>Data Bits 8
>Stop Bits 1
>Parity None
>Protocol
DTR(pos.)&XON
Range
1200, 2400, 4800, 9600 (Default),
19200, 38400, 57600, 115200
7 or 8 (Default)
1 (Default) or 2
None (Default), Odd, Even, or Ignore
DTR(pos.)& Xon (Default), DTR(positive), DTR(negative), XON/XOFF, or ETX/ACK
For example, to change baud rate from 9600 to 115200, display the baud rate menu following the above procedure. When the display shows baud rate, 9600 (bps), press [OK] ([ENTER]). A blinking question mark (?) appears.
>Baud Rate ?
9600
7 | Press U or V to scroll through values. When 115200 is displayed, press |
| [OK] ([ENTER]). Press [MENU] to exit the menu selection. |
NOTE: Some computers may not be able to handle a baud rate of 115200 bps. If you set the baud rate to 115200 and encounter communication problems, select a lower baud rate.
